1. Understanding the Core of a Yield Optimization Tutorial Development Framework
A yield optimization tutorial development framework is a structured methodology for designing, building, and delivering educational content about maximizing returns on digital investments. This framework helps developers, content creators, and DeFi enthusiasts create tutorials that are both technically accurate and highly engaging.
At its foundation, the framework integrates three pillars: educational design, technical precision, and user experience. Unlike generic tutorials, a yield optimization framework ensures your content teaches users how to identify, execute, and manage high-yield strategies efficiently.
Key components of the framework include:
- Learning objectives aligned with real-world yield optimization scenarios
- Step-by-step walkthroughs with screenshots and code examples
- Interactive elements like calculators or sandbox environments
- Performance metrics to measure tutorial success
- Version control for updating content as platforms evolve
The framework prioritizes scannability — users often skim tutorials before deep-diving. Bullet points, short paragraphs, and clear headings help readers find what they need quickly. This approach ensures your tutorial development process is reusable and scalable, whether you're covering DeFi staking, liquidity mining, or arbitrage bots.
2. Step-by-Step Architecture: How the Framework Operates
The yield optimization tutorial development framework follows a modular architecture that separates concerns — content creation, technical implementation, and feedback integration. This makes updates less disruptive and allows multiple contributors to work simultaneously.
Phase 1: Research and Audience Definition
First, identify who will use the tutorial. Beginners need foundational concepts, while advanced users expect deep technical dives. Common audience segments include developers, DeFi farmers, or retail investors looking to automate strategy without manual oversight.
Phase 2: Framework Structure Design
Define the tutorial's learning path. A typical sequence includes:
- Introduction — short overview of the yield optimization concept
- Prerequisites — required tools, knowledge, and accounts
- Step-by-step instructions — numbered actions with visuals
- Code snippets — ready-to-use scripts (e.g., for compounding rewards)
- Troubleshooting — common errors and solutions
- Next steps — what users should try next
Phase 3: Content Production with Tools
Use markdown editors, screen recorders, and sandbox environments. For example, integrate a live code editor so users can test scripts directly. This practical approach helps beginners learn how to automate strategy effectively, reducing friction between theory and execution.
Phase 4: Testing and Loop Feedback
Launch the tutorial with a small audience first. Track where users drop off, which steps confuse them, and how often they revisit sections. Apply changes within the framework without rewriting everything. Use analytics to measure completion rates and quiz scores.
This architecture ensures your yield optimization tutorials remain accurate as protocols upgrade and market conditions shift. The modular design makes it easy to swap outdated sections with new information.
3. Best Practices for Building Effective Yield Optimization Tutorials
Creating tutorials that convert passive readers into active implementers requires more than just listing steps. Use these best practices to ensure your framework delivers real value.
Keep it actionable — every section should end with a takeaway or prompt to act. For example, after explaining compound yield calculations, users should try the formula with real numbers.
Prioritize clarity over jargon — define every technical term (e.g., “APY,” “slippage,” “gas fees”) the first time it appears. Use analogies for complex mechanics.
Include visual references — screenshots with annotated arrows, flowcharts for decision trees, and code syntax highlighting are essential. Visuals reduce reading time by 40%.
Break down advanced concepts — for instance, when discussing Yield Optimization Techniques, separate them into beginner, intermediate, and advanced tiers within the same tutorial, using collapsible sections.
Integrate automation examples — demonstrate how users can automate rebalancing or reinvestment using simple scripts. Show both the code and expected outcomes to build confidence.
Test with different audiences — try the tutorial with both experienced developers and non-technical users. Adjust the timeline explanation for each group.
Common mistakes to avoid:
- Using outdated contract addresses or protocols
- Missing error-handling instructions
- Overcomplicating with excessive options
- Ignoring mobile readability (many users access tutorials on phones)
A good framework makes your tutorials evergreen. When new yield optimization strategies appear, you update only the relevant module, keeping the rest intact. This saves time and maintains consistency.
4. Tools and Technologies That Power the Framework
Selecting the right tools accelerates your yield optimization tutorial development. Here is a curated list of technologies commonly embedded in the framework:
- Documentation generators (Docusaurus, GitBook) — create structured, versioned content
- Screen capture tools (OBS Studio, CleanShot X) — high-quality tutorial recordings
- Code sandboxes (CodeSandbox, Replit) — allow users to execute scripts in mock environments
- Analytics platforms (Google Analytics, Hotjar) — heatmaps and drop-off analysis
- LLM-assisted editing (ChatGPT, Copy.ai) — generate draft text, summaries, and quiz questions
- Version control (Git, Hugging Face Spaces) — track updates and rollback changes
Combine these tools into a pipeline: research → draft → code → record → publish → measure → update. The framework should integrate seamlessly with existing workflows like GitHub Pages or Notion.
For coding-heavy content, consider providing pre-built templates. For example, a simple Python script that calculates optimal reinvestment intervals can be embedded directly. Users can copy, modify, and run it instantaneously.
5. Measuring Tutorial Effectiveness and Scaling the Framework
Once your yield optimization tutorial development framework is active, measuring its performance confirms whether users actually learn and apply the strategies.
Key performance indicators (KPIs):
- Completion rate — percentage of users who finish all steps
- Time to completion — average minutes to finish the tutorial
- Task success rate — whether users achieve the stated outcome (e.g., set up a yield bot)
- Revisitation rate — how often users return to the tutorial as a reference
- Feedback score — net promoter score (NPS) or star rating
Use built-in quizzing modules or write post-tutorial surveys to gauge deep understanding. Embed small challenges at the end of each section to reinforce learning.
To scale the framework, create a template system. Every new yield optimization strategy (e.g., auto-compounding vaults, yield aggregators, liquidation bots) can be transformed into a structured tutorial by filling the template. This standardization reduces production time by 60%.
Additionally, implement a feedback loop where users suggest optimizations or report errors. Tie this to a changelog so that tutorial accuracy improves continuously. Over time, the framework becomes self-improving based on user interactions.
Finally, share your framework as an open-source blueprint so that other creators can adapt it to their own domains (e.g., crypto staking, forex yield, or even affiliate marketing). This builds community and expands your audience base.
By systematizing the tutorial creation process, you ensure each educational piece delivers genuine value — from the first search query to the final successful yield optimization.